Description:
(±)-Atropine is a tropane alkaloid derived from plants of the Solanaceae family, notably belladonna (Atropa belladonna). It is a racemic mixture of two enantiomers, (R)-atropine and (S)-atropine, which exhibit different pharmacological properties. Atropine is a tertiary amine with the molecular formula C17H23NO3 and a molecular weight of approximately 289.37 g/mol. It is characterized by its ability to act as a competitive antagonist of the muscarinic acetylcholine receptors, leading to effects such as increased heart rate, dilation of pupils, and reduced secretions. Atropine is soluble in organic solvents like alcohol and chloroform but has limited solubility in water. Its applications are diverse, including use in medicine as an antidote for organophosphate poisoning, in ophthalmology for pupil dilation, and in anesthesia to reduce salivation. However, it can also cause side effects such as dry mouth, blurred vision, and tachycardia, particularly when used in higher doses. Due to its potent effects, atropine must be administered with caution.
